Based on a geographical scale, the different types of networks are: Nanoscale networks: These networks enable communication between minuscule … WebFeb 23, 2024 · A network is a set of devices (often referred to as nodes) connected by communication links. Or a network is simply two or more computers that are linked together. A node can be a computer, printer, or any other device capable of sending and/or receiving data generated by other nodes on the network.
